The Edo Ministry of Youths and Special Duties said it had generated about N15. 2 million from January till date against the proposed N24 million target for the ministry in 2018.

Mr Mika Amanokha, the state Commissioner for Youths and Special Duties, disclosed this on the floor of Edo House of Assembly during the ministerial briefing which began on Monday.

Amanokha said the revenue was generated from the use of facilities at Samuel Ogbemudia Stadium.

”The ministry would have been able to meet the target of N24 million if the renovation work at the main bowl of the stadium was completed,” he said.

The Speaker, Rt Hon. Kabiru Adjoto, expressed dismay on the growing cases of young girls engaging in prostitution, particularly around the Ihama road axis of Benin city.

Adjoto urged the Commissioner to ensure that the ministry rid all the adjoining streets around the legislative quarters in Benin City of girls waiting for prospective customers.

Responding, the Commissioner said that he was not aware of activities of the girls around the Ihama road axis, but said that the ministry would do a surveillance around the area to address the problem.
